HAMER TOWNSHIP, Ohio — A man is dead after a crash involving four vehicles in Highland County on Sunday, according to the Ohio State Highway Patrol.
OSHP said the crash happened at around 8:49 p.m. Sunday evening on SR-138 in Hamer Township.
Troopers have determined that 37-year-old Daniel Vance, of Sardenia, was driving a 1973 Plymouth Duster southwest on SR-138 when he traveled left of the center line. Vance crashed into a 2008 Chevy Colorado and a 2004 Dodge Dakota, both of which were being driven by 17-year-old juveniles.
A fourth vehicle, a 2019 Ford Ranger, that had also been heading southwest on SR-138, then hit the Dodge after the initial crash, OSHP said.
Vance was pronounced dead at the scene of the crash; one of the teens and the adult driver of the Ford were both treated for minor injuries.
OSHP did not say what may have caused the crash, which is still under investigation.
